P (6, -4) ; y = 1/3x + 1
Put answer in point slope form

Answer:

y+4 = 1/3(x - 6)

Step-by-step explanation:

(y-y1) = m(x-x1), Point-slope form.

y = 1/3x + 1, slope m = 1/3

P(6, -4), so x1 = 6, y1 = - 4

(y-(-4)) = 1/3(x-6)

y+4 = 1/3(x - 6)
